Generation No. 1 | |||
1. Joseph Foster, brewer's labourer He was born 1828 at Frant, Sussex | |||
He married Sophia on c 1848. She was born 1830 at Frant, Sussex. They had the following children: | |||
i | Maryann who was born 1850 at Frant, Sussex | ||
2 | ii | Jacob who was born 1851 at Frant, Sussex; christened 7th Dec 1851 St. Alban's Church, Frant, Sussex, son of Joseph Foster (labourer) and Sophia Foster | |
iii | Thomas who was born 1855 at Frant, Sussex; christened 29th Apr 1855 St. Alban's Church, Frant, Sussex, son of Joseph Foster (labourer) and Sophia Foster | ||
iv | Joseph who was born 1856 at Frant, Sussex; christened 9th Nov 1856 St. Alban's Church, Frant, Sussex, son of Joseph Foster (labourer) and Sophia Foster | ||
v | Jonathan who was born 1858 at Frant, Sussex; christened 21st Nov 1858 St. Alban's Church, Frant, Sussex, son of Joseph Foster (labourer) and Sophia Foster | ||
vi | James who was born 1860 at Frant, Sussex; christened 27th Feb 1860 St. Alban's Church, Frant, Sussex, son of Joseph Foster (labourer) and Sophia Foster | ||
vii | Ruth who was born 1861 at Frant, Sussex; christened 23rd Jun 1861 St. Alban's Church, Frant, Sussex, daughter of Joseph Foster (brewer) and Sophia Foster | ||
viii | Joseph who was born 1863 at Frant, Sussex; christened 13th Sep 1863 St. Alban's Church, Frant, Sussex, son of Joseph Foster (brewer) and Sophia Foster | ||
Generation No. 2 | |||
2. Jacob Foster, labourer was the son of Joseph Foster, brewer's labourer and Sophia Foster. He was born 1851 at Frant, Sussex; christened 7th Dec 1851 at St. Alban's Church, Frant, Sussex, son of Joseph Foster (labourer) and Sophia Foster | |||
He married Annie Matcham on July to Sep 1878, registered at Tonbridge District, Kent, ref: 1878 Q3 Vol 2a Page 917. She was born 1852 at Frant, Sussex. They had the following children: | |||
i | William T. who was born 1879 at Tunbridge Wells, Kent | ||
